Nové Mitrovice

Nové Mitrovice is a village in Western Bohemia, the Czech Republic. Located in southwestern part of Brdy mountains, ca. 30 km southeast of Pilsen, 562 meters above sea level. The village is surrounded by forested hills, namely Nad Maráskem (800 m. ), Kokšín (684 m. ) and Korálka (624 m.). Several water-streams join in the valley forming Mítovský potok that drains the area.

Brdy

Brdy are hills in the Czech Republic, forming a long massif stretching for cca.60 km from Prague in the direction of southwest. The northern section of the Brdy is called "Hřebeny" and features one narrow ridge (highest elevation Písek - 690 m.). The Brdy proper starts south of the Litavka river gorge and consists of several major elevations connected into one plateau. The highest being "Tok" (864 m. ), "Praha" (862 m. ) or "Třemšín" (827 m.).

Kozel Castle

Kozel is a hunting castle in classic style close to the city of Plzeň, Czech Republic. The castle was built at the end of 18th century by architect Václav Haberditz for Jan Vojtěch of Czernin. It is a ground-floor building around the inner rectangular court. Around the castle we can find also a chapel, riding school and a stable. The areal is surrounded by a large park. Šťáhlavy

Šťáhlavy is a village in Plzeň-City District, 14 km south-east from Plzeň. Šťáhlavy is important touristic destination - Kozel Castle, Radyně Castle and ruine of Lopata Castle.
